Understanding Vehicle Security : Investigating Code Grabbers & Options
The growing threat of auto theft has driven developers to explore new techniques for securing the automobile . A concerning development is the rise of "code grabbers," tools that attempt to steal authentication codes from key fobs . These unauthorized pieces of equipment typically function by observing the radio signal emitted by your fob , allowing them to copy it and gain illegal access to your car . Fortunately, numerous solutions exist to mitigate this threat. These encompass :
- Relocating your key transmitter away from possible locations of blockage.
- Implementing key fob protective containers which block radio transmissions .
- Enabling security features provided by a automobile's manufacturer , such as frequency hopping .
- Opting for different keyless access solutions .
Remaining informed about the developing risks and adopting preventative measures can greatly enhance your vehicle 's protection.
